UV GigE Industrial camera

The UV GigE Vision camera MER3-810-36G3M-P-UV is equipped with the Sony "Pregius S" CMOS sensor specially designed for the wavelength between 200nm to 400nm. It has a 8MP resolution and is capable of 2.5Gbits/s at maximum transfer data rate. The IMX487 image sensor can capture UV images and features Pregius S™ technology for smooth global shutter operation and fast performance. It's useful for various tasks such as semiconductor inspection, defect detection, discharge inspection, recycling, printing, and life sciences.

Besides using glass with high UV transmittance for the upper section of the image sensor and the pixel on-chip lenses, a specialized structure for UV is utilized around the photodiode. This design ensures a high UV sensitivity while maintaining quality imaging with minimal noise. Moreover, the pixels capture UV light efficiently. This leads to high a light sensitivity and a small pixel size of 2.74 µm, enabling 8 megapixels resolution even on a compact 2/3” sensor format.

What is UV?

See outside the visible spectrum with UV cameras. This innovative technology unlocks a new dimension in machine vision, allowing you to inspect objects from a whole new perspective in the other range of the light spectrum. 
The diagram below illustrates the power of ultraviolet (UV) light. Unlike visible light, UV light has shorter wavelengths (between 10 and 400 nanometers). Our IMX487 sensor capitalizes on this, operating within the 200-400 nm range. This allows industrial applications to see what was previously invisible – a whole new world revealed through the power of the UV wavelength.

INDUSTRIAL CAMERA WITH POE 

Power over Ethernet (PoE) for GigE is designed to provide both power and data communication over a standard Ethernet cable. This reduces the amount of cables and installation time in applications that do not require a hardware trigger or I/O. When I/O is required in an application we advise to supply power to the camera via an I/O connector. The camera’s power usage is larger when using Power over Ethernet than via the I/O connector. In addition, the camera will generate extra heat when regulating the power transmitted via PoE to required values. The advantage of PoE is that installation is easier because fewer cables are required.

UV Lenses

When you combine cameras equipped with UV image sensors together with UV lighting and UV lenses, the system provides special visual information which ordinary cameras for visible light imaging cannot.
